## Action Item: Cron Drift Follow-up

The nightly reconciliation job on the Lanternworks batch cluster drifted 43 minutes over two weeks because workers synced time against a deprecated internal source. We will migrate all schedulers to the shared timing service and add a drift alarm at the five-minute mark. New team members: note that cron hosts must never set time locally — always defer to the timing service. Full migration steps and the rollout calendar are documented on the internal page below.

dashboard of tahaf-fadug = https://grafana.qorvelcorp.internal/browse/browse/job/557b2263e0b5

Handover note — Crumbwheel order cutoffs.

Welcome aboard. The bakery cutoff rule in Crumbwheel closes same-day orders at 14:00 local to each storefront, not UTC — this has bitten us twice. Holiday overrides live in the calendar service and take precedence silently, so always check there first when a cutoff looks wrong. To unlock the calendar service's admin console after a restart, enter the recovery passphrase below.

vault phrase of bagap-bahaf = silion-pelox-sorox-casdor-quenwyn-fraax-eliox-praael-kelion-quenvan-kasox-rusael-norius-belvan

Hi Marek — quick handover on the read-replica lag alarm for the Ashgrove cluster. It fires when the replica trails the primary by more than 45 seconds. Nine times out of ten it's the nightly analytics job hogging the replica; it usually clears itself within 20 minutes, so check the job schedule before escalating. If lag keeps climbing past an hour, page the storage folks — don't restart replication yourself, it makes things worse. Full triage steps are on the internal page here.

wiki page, kajef-fahop: https://confluence.qorvelworks.corp/view/projects/pages/20cd971ffb91

**Action item: DNS flakiness in Quillbird staging**

Support folks — the intermittent lookup failures traced back to an overly aggressive resolver cache in the Marrowgate proxy. We're not changing behavior yet, just making the knobs visible so you can sanity-check tickets before escalating. Tamsin owns the follow-up patch. For reference, here are the current resolver tuning constants.

tuning constants:
QUOTAS = {
    "druwyn": 5,
    "holix": 5,
    "zorath": 5,
    "holwyn": 10,
}